Camera Adapter Axial Coupling Eliminates Rattling
Find Innovative SolutionsGenerate Solutions
Solution Overview
Problem
Interchangeable lens type image pickup apparatuses experience increased rattling when using an adapter apparatus between the camera body and camera accessory due to the need for bayonet coupling at two locations, which existing technologies do not effectively address.
Innovation Solution
An adapter apparatus with a first cylinder and a second cylinder that are axially movable, featuring claw portions for engagement with the camera body and accessory, allowing for secure coupling without rattling through a screw-type mount mechanism.

AI summary
A mount adapter couples a camera body and an interchangeable lens without rattling. The mount adapter includes a fixed cylinder and a movable cylinder that engages with the fixed cylinder and is movable in an optical axis direction with respect to the fixed cylinder. The fixed cylinder has a first mount surface that comes into contact with the camera body and a second mount surface that comes into contact with the interchangeable lens. The movable cylinder has first mount claw portions that engage with mount claw portions of the camera body and second mount claw portions that engage with mount claw portions of the interchangeable lens.
